The Financial Challenges Cleaning Businesses Face

Higher Labour Costs

Cleaner wages, overtime and contractor payments can quickly increase costs.

Rising Expenses

Supplies, equipment, vehicles and other overheads can reduce your margins.

Late Payments

Delayed client payments can put pressure on cash flow.

Unclear Profitability

Without job-level tracking, you may not know which contracts are truly profitable.

Bookkeeping Falls Behind

Busy cleaning operations can leave little time to keep your Financial records up to date.

Cleaning businesses manage recurring invoices, staff payroll, supplies, equipment and multiple client payments. Without organized accounting, these financial tasks can make it difficult to control costs, manage cash flow and understand true profitability.

Bank Reconciliation

Bank reconciliation helps ensure that your accounting records match your actual bank activity.

Our bank reconciliation support may include:

  • Matching bank transactions with accounting records
  • Identifying missing or duplicate entries
  • Reviewing discrepancies and unusual transactions
  • Checking outstanding transactions
  • Keeping reconciled records up to date

Accounts Receivable Support

Late customer payments can create cash-flow pressure, especially when you have regular expenses such as cleaner wages, supplies, transport, and equipment costs.

We can help organize outstanding invoices, track unpaid balances, and keep your receivables records up to date. This gives you a clearer view of what customers owe, which invoices are overdue, and how much cash you can expect to receive.

Accounts Payable Records

Keeping track of supplier and business payments helps prevent missed, late, or duplicated payments.

We organize your outstanding bills and payment records so you can see what your cleaning business owes and when payments are due. This may include expenses for cleaning supplies, equipment, contractors, software, insurance, and other business providers.
